Pitching Dominated the MLB on Wednesday

April 23rd 2009 15:09
Pitching dominated Wednesday's action as five shutouts were thrown. Barry Zito, Jair Jurrjens, Brian Bannister, Johnny Cueto, and Dan Haren each started a game where their opponent was shut out. Haren threw seven shutout innings, allowing six hits and striking out nine. Cueto allowed four hits, striking out three in seven innings, Bannister allowed four hits in six innings and Jurrjens allowed six hits in seven-plus innings. Zito had his best outing since his days in an Oakland uniform and pitching seven scoreless innings, allowing six hits and striking out five. There has been 29 shutouts already this season. According to Elias Sports Bureau, the record for the most shutouts in a day was eight and that occurred on June 4, 1972.
